In2005, Candes and Donoho proposed Compressive Sensing theory,which is amilestone in the history. The theory breakthrough the limit of Nyquist Theory.It solve thesignal processing bottleneck: sampling frequency is at least twice as many as the originalsignal,if it can be complete without loss of precise original signal from the sampling.Compressive Sensing theory is a new theory, which compress datas while sampling. It doesnot need compress after sampling. Principle of prior knowledge is used in CompressiveSensing that signal is sparse or compressibility.It is different from Nyquist Theory which onlyuses bandwidth of signal as its prior knowledge.It provides the possibility.to reduce the cost ofsignal measurement.Sparse is a very important part in the image Compressive Sensing theory.The Thetraditional sparse representation use wavelet transform generally. But the wavelet transformcan’t use the geometry characteristic of signal,so it can not achieve the optimal sparse.Compression sensing reconstruction also can’t get the best results with wavelet transform.In order to solve the problem above, Image Compressed sensing based on Bandelettransform domain is proposed after researching variety of sparse representation. Bandelettransform is a mage representation method unfolds in recent years. It can make full use of thegeometry of the image achieve the optimal sparse representation.
